One day while hiking in 2022, I came upon a sign that warned of a recent bear sighting in the area. The sign included a bullet-pointed list of tips on what to do if you come across a bear. One of the tips was to “appear large”—hold your arms over head, use your jacket to make it look like you’re bigger than you are, do whatever it takes to add to your visual presence. The week I saw this sign happened to be the week I started this Substack, so now I have a Substack called “Art Edwards Appears Large.”
The title was extemporaneous, and at first, so were the pieces. I started posting songs and writings on my latest solo project. I soon found myself publishing nonfiction pieces I loved but couldn’t find homes for elsewhere.
I eventually started writing pieces specifically for Substack. These tended to be on writing, publishing, or culture topics that I felt were relevant to contemporary times. While I still write and publish whatever I want, a certain framework has emerged for my Substack:
I publish about one piece per month.
I write on topics that cut against the prevailing trends in writing and publishing.
I distrust technology as any kind of replacement for fundamental artistic and human achievement.
I put physical books and songs at the center of my concerns.
I promote my books and music.
Well into its fourth year, Art Edwards Appears Large has evolved into a necessary part of my writing and music life. I’m glad it’s here, and I’m glad you’re here to read it.
